CFO’s
Roles and Responsibilities

Taxation & Regulatory

A CFO ensures compliance with tax laws and regulatory requirements, minimizing risks and optimizing tax efficiency. They oversee tax planning, filings, and liaise with tax authorities to ensure that the organization remains compliant with evolving tax regulations.

Governance, Risk and Compliance

The CFO plays a crucial role in maintaining corporate governance, identifying potential risks, and ensuring regulatory compliance. By implementing robust risk management frameworks, they safeguard the organization from financial and legal threats.

Efficiency and Performance Improvement

The CFO identifies opportunities to improve operational efficiency and financial performance. By implementing cost control measures, process optimizations, and performance tracking mechanisms, they enhance business profitability.

Managing Capital

Efficient capital management is vital for business sustainability and growth. The CFO oversees working capital, debt financing, and investment strategies to ensure optimal allocation of resources and financial stability.

Financial Reporting & Accounting

Accurate financial reporting and accounting are critical for business transparency and decision-making. The CFO ensures compliance with accounting standards, prepares financial statements, and provides insights for strategic planning.

Cybersecurity, Digital & Analytics

In the digital era, financial data security is paramount. The CFO collaborates with IT teams to implement cybersecurity measures, leverage data analytics for financial insights, and adopt digital transformation strategies to enhance financial operations.

Talent Management

A CFO is responsible for building a strong finance team, attracting top talent, and fostering a culture of continuous learning. Effective talent management ensures that the finance function remains efficient and aligned with business goals.

Funding for Growth

Securing funding is essential for business expansion. The CFO evaluates funding options, including equity, debt, and strategic partnerships, to support growth initiatives and ensure sustainable financial health.
